Family tree Trox » Elizabeth Savory (Savery) (± 1607-????)

Personal data Elizabeth Savory (Savery) 

  • She was born about 1607 in Hannington, Wiltshire, England.
  • She was christened on September 15, 1608.
  • She died in Bristol, Massachusetts, Verenigde Staten.
  • A child of Thomas Seaver and Mary Woodcocke
  • This information was last updated on January 13, 2022.

Household of Elizabeth Savory (Savery)

She is married to Samuel Fosten Eddy.

They got married in the year 1630.


Child(ren):

  1. Obadiah Eddy  ± 1645-1727
